After commit bb996692bd9 "RISC-V/gas: allow generating up to 176-bit
instructions with .insn", I started to see some crashes while running
"make check-gas".
The cause was simple. Some functions depended on the fact that maximum
length returned by riscv_insn_length is 8. But since the commit above
increased that upper limit from 64-bits (8 bytes) to 176-bits (22 bytes),
we need to increase two buffer sizes to avoid crashes.
But note that this change doesn't really support over 64-bit instructions.
At least we can safely ignore those long instructions but we must remember
that we are still in a partial support for 176-bit instructions.
[Changes: v1 -> v2]
- Fix assertion failure on riscv_insn::decode
- Use new constant RISCV_MAX_INSN_LEN for buffer size
